Total Time: 10 minsCategory: Spice Powder1. Dry roast all ingredients except bay leaf and dry red chili in a pan. Make sure you dry roast in medium flame, so the spices do not get burnt.
2. When a nice aroma arises from coriander seeds, switch off. It takes around 5 to minutes. Remove it to a plate.
3. Add bay leaf and dry red chili and switch off the stove.
4. Grind all ingredients coarsely using a blender or mortar and pestle.

Cuisine: North IndianTotal Time: 50 minsCategory: LunchCalories: 237 per serving1. Take a chopping board and chop cauliflower, garlic, ginger, green chilies, tomatoes, onions, coriander leaves over it. Cut carrot into small pieces and french beans into diagonal pieces. Chop paneer into cubes.
2. Mix curd, green chilies, gram flour, pinch of turmeric and 4 cups of water in a bowl. Heat oil in a pan and saute mustard seeds, garlic, cumin seeds and ginger in it.
3. Add cauliflower pieces, onions, curry leaves, carrot, onions, green peas and beans. Saute dried fenugreek leaves, salt and pinch of turmeric in it. Mix in chopped tomatoes. Saute for 2 minutes.
4. Pour the flour-yogurt mixture into the pan and cook it for 4-5 minutes. Mix in coriander leaves and paneer cubes. Bring it to a boil and then transfer it to serving bowls. Enjoy!

How to make kadhi pakora?

To begin with the Kadhi Pakora, take onions, green chilies, wash them and chop them. Followed by coriander leaves. Take a large bowl and add in the besan (gramflour) add salt, red chili powder, carom seeds, mix it well with water. Make a smooth batter, which is not to runny. Add the onions, coriander leaves and green chilies. Mix it all together.
